Fault Inspection Procedure
Check the GCON ECM
1
Disconnect the GCON ECM connectors, J1, J2 and J3.
2
For short to B- type faults, measure resistance between
pins J1-7 (ground) and the GCON pin associated with the
fault code. Refer to the GCON I/O Map in this section to
identify the faulted out circuit pin.
3
Short to ground resistance should be greater than 5k Ω.
4
For short to B+ type faults, measure resistance between
pins J1-12 (driver power) and the GCON pin associated
with the fault code. Refer to the GCON I/O Map in this
section to identify the faulted out circuit pin.
5
Short to power resistance should be greater than 50k Ω.
